Homebrew Loading ELF file on boot?

  • Thread starter Thread starter Samie
  • Start date Start date
  • Views Views 3,678
  • Replies Replies 4

Samie

Member
Newcomer
Joined
Oct 20, 2018
Messages
19
Reaction score
0
Trophies
0
Age
34
XP
208
Country
Canada
Would you guys have any info on how that could be done or if it's possible? (Using haxchi)
 
If you use cbhc and rename the file to mocha.elf and put it in your mocha app folder and set cbhc to autoboot mocha, it will launch whatever elf is there. However, this requires cbhc. Haxchi on it's own cannot do this, but you're probably going to be safe using cbhc.
 
  • Like
Reactions: Samie
If you use cbhc and rename the file to mocha.elf and put it in your mocha app folder and set cbhc to autoboot mocha, it will launch whatever elf is there. However, this requires cbhc. Haxchi on it's own cannot do this, but you're probably going to be safe using cbhc.

Whoops! Yep I'm actually using coldboot Haxchi, so I guess it's already doing what I'm asking for whenever the WiiU boots on. If you don't mind me asking though, is there anyway to boot a second elf file? Or if I did the mocha stuff you mentioned, I'm assuming it wouldn't be loading Haxchi automatically anymore?

The reason I ask is because I have a couple apps from the homebrew store that need to be ran manually everytime I boot up. One that turns off the Wii U gamepad display, and another that can switch the Wii U display with the TV display -- both run in the background and get triggered whenever a certain button is pushed.

But I'd need to also have Haxchi loading on boot too. But.. Guessing its not possible aside from somehow getting the source code for haxchi and modifying/recompiling the extra features into it? Or
 
Unfortunately, it not possible to automatically load two elfs on boot. Although, there are a couple modified cbhc on here somewhere that do allow having two separate options for loading elf files you can only auto boot one.

However, there is the WiiUPluginSystem which can be auto booted and does support both Padcon and SwipSwapMe and a bunch of other stuff like SDCafiine (game mods) and a Screenshot Plugin. When launched, you just have to choose which ones you want (it won't remember) and then you enter the button combos (also have to do this every time) and bam you are in. Here is the Discord with download links for it and all the plugins: https://discord.gg/dPruNxX Keep in mind it's still in development, but I've personally ever only see it crash by loading way too many plugins and it's not during gameplay though you may experience different results.

Couple things to note however is that it will automatically load into the first user on the console. Although you can make a user a default user by clicking your mii on the home menu and scrolling down. Also, the homebrew launcher will launch everytime you load Mii Maker (just like with the browser exploit) so just quit out of it to access Miis. If you want to change your user Mii however, doing it normally will take you to homebrew launcher and then to standard Mii Maker, not edit User Mii. In order to edit your User Mii you need to reboot and enter Hakchi menu and load System Menu manually.

Also it's always loading Hakchi, all hakchi features like custom apps and "backups" and all that still work. The only thing the Mocha option does is load the elf file that is named mocha.elf. It doesn't have any effect on functionality.
 
  • Like
Reactions: Samie
Unfortunately, it not possible to automatically load two elfs on boot. Although, there are a couple modified cbhc on here somewhere that do allow having two separate options for loading elf files you can only auto boot one.

However, there is the WiiUPluginSystem which can be auto booted and does support both Padcon and SwipSwapMe and a bunch of other stuff like SDCafiine (game mods) and a Screenshot Plugin. When launched, you just have to choose which ones you want (it won't remember) and then you enter the button combos (also have to do this every time) and bam you are in. Here is the Discord with download links for it and all the plugins: https://discord.gg/dPruNxX Keep in mind it's still in development, but I've personally ever only see it crash by loading way too many plugins and it's not during gameplay though you may experience different results.

Couple things to note however is that it will automatically load into the first user on the console. Although you can make a user a default user by clicking your mii on the home menu and scrolling down. Also, the homebrew launcher will launch everytime you load Mii Maker (just like with the browser exploit) so just quit out of it to access Miis. If you want to change your user Mii however, doing it normally will take you to homebrew launcher and then to standard Mii Maker, not edit User Mii. In order to edit your User Mii you need to reboot and enter Hakchi menu and load System Menu manually.

Also it's always loading Hakchi, all hakchi features like custom apps and "backups" and all that still work. The only thing the Mocha option does is load the elf file that is named mocha.elf. It doesn't have any effect on functionality.

Thanks for the help :P I don't mind manually loading this stuff when booting up the WiiU, but the problem is for my younger sons who are playing and wouldn't want them messing around in homebrew or anything like that. But anyways it's not too big a deal. Although it sounds like I can do one ELF file with the mocha thing you mentioned so I think I like the idea of maybe in the future getting the sourcecode for whatever features I want and then customizing/compiling them into one ELF and renaming to mocha.elf.

I think it should work as long as it's done correctly and I'm also careful not to brick lol Anyways thanks again for the help!
 

Site & Scene News

Popular threads in this forum